What is a Yottahertz?
The Yottahertz (YHz) is a unit of frequency equal to one septillion hertz.
What is a Revolutions per Hour?
The Revolutions per Hour (r/h) is a unit of angular velocity equal to one rotation every hour.
How to Convert Yottahertz to Revolutions per Hour
To convert Yottahertz to Revolutions per Hour, multiply the Yottahertz value by 3.6e+27.
